#e711bd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e711bd is composed of 90.6% red, 6.7%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.6% magenta, 18.2%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 311.8 degrees, a saturation of 86.3% and a lightness of 48.6%. #e711bd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ff22ff with #cf007b. Closest websafe color is: #ff00cc.

#e711bd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e711bd has RGB values of R:231, G:17,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.18,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15143357.

Shades and Tints of #e711bd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c010a is the darkest color, while #fff8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#e711bd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7a7d is the less saturated color, while #f107c3 is the most saturated one.
